Malaysia has appointed Abdul Halim Bin Aman as its new anti-graft chief, replacing Azam Baki when his term ends next month. This development is expected to have minimal direct market impact. The change in leadership may influence corruption perceptions and governance, potentially affecting investor sentiment in the long term.

The appointment of a new anti-graft chief in Malaysia is unlikely to have an immediate significant impact on asset prices or market sectors. However, improved governance and reduced corruption could positively reflect on the Malaysian economy and stock market in the medium to long term.
